SGT University Hosts I-SHINE 2025 – AI Global Summit for Sustainable Nation-Building
SGT University successfully organized the International Summit on Holistic Innovations for Nations’ Empowerment (I-SHINE 2025 – AI), a two-day global conference that focused on the transformative potential of Artificial Intelligence (AI) in shaping India’s future. Held in a hybrid format, the summit attracted renowned academics, industry experts, policymakers, and researchers from around the world.
The central theme of the summit was “Harnessing Artificial Intelligence for Sustainable Growth: Envisioning a Viksit Bharat by 2047,” closely aligning with India’s long-term development goals. It emphasized AI as a tool for national empowerment and global leadership.
The summit began with a welcome address by Dr. Hemant Verma, Vice-Chancellor of SGT University, who stressed the importance of ethical AI, interdisciplinary research, and education reform for inclusive and sustainable growth. He highlighted SGT University’s commitment to innovation-driven progress.
The inaugural session featured Prof. Mohd. Afshar Alam, Vice-Chancellor of Jamia Hamdard University, as the Chief Guest, and Mr. Sunil Sharma, Managing Director – Sales (India & SAARC) at Sophos, as the Guest of Honour.
Day one included thought-provoking sessions led by global AI experts. Dr. Hari Prasad Devkota from Kumamoto University in Japan addressed AI’s emerging role in global health and science communication. Dr. Maanak Gupta from Tennessee Tech University examined the ethical and societal impacts of AI. Dr. Srinivas, Director at Stanome, discussed the integration of AI with genomics for crop innovation and food security. Dr. Vikas Kannojiya presented India’s first AI-powered artificial heart assistive device.
The second day featured a keynote address by Prof. Cory Glickman from Infosys, USA, which focused on AI’s role in achieving sustainability and resilience. Dr. Waqar M. Naqvi, Director at AD Vivum Education & Research in Qatar, discussed the integration of AI in healthcare, highlighting its global impact on diagnostics and treatment models.
Other key speakers included Dr. Khalid Raza from Jamia Millia Islamia, Mr. Kishan Srivastava from SDLC Corp in Dubai, and Mr. Shivam Dwivedi, an Engineering Architect at Code & Theory in New York, who shared insights on AI across various industries.
The summit concluded with a valedictory session featuring Shri Indresh Kumar Ji, a National Executive Member of the RSS, as the Chief Guest, and Dr. Harnath Babu, Partner and CIO at KPMG, as the Guest of Honour.
I-SHINE 2025 saw participation from institutions across 19 Indian states and several prestigious national and global partners, including AIIMS Delhi, KGMU Lucknow, Harvard Medical School (USA), BAM (Germany), and USDA (USA).
The summit emphasized the importance of collaboration between academia, industry, and government, focusing on real-world AI applications in healthcare, education, urban development, governance, and environmental sustainability.
